    A Message of Encouragement to Our Grade 6 Students

    Published on

    spot_img

    By Jermaine N. Edwards, Community Advocate, St. John’s Rural South

    As you prepare to take your Common Entrance Exams, I want you to pause for just a moment and feel the pride that surrounds you, not only from your teachers and your families but from your entire community, and indeed, our entire nation of Antigua and Barbuda.

    We are proud of you.

    You have worked so hard, and every step you’ve taken to reach this moment is already a success in itself. These exams are not a measure of your worth. They are a stepping stone. A bridge to the next chapter of your life. One chapter in a story that is still being written, with endless pages of possibility ahead.

    This is just one step. Do not overthink it. Do not undervalue it. Cherish it. Live fully in this moment, knowing that everything you need is already within you.

    Settle your mind. Steady your thoughts. Walk into that exam room already knowing that you are capable. You are strong. You are intelligent. You are enough.

    No matter what the results may say, they do not define you. Your character, your courage, your dreams, your kindness, these are the things that shape your greatness. And we see that greatness in you already.

    You are the future of our nation. You are the hope we hold in our hearts. We think so highly of you. We love you. We cherish you. And we are all cheering you on. Every one of us, from every corner of St. John’s Rural South, and from every parish across Antigua and Barbuda.

    We are looking forward to what comes next. The new friendships. The discoveries. The growth. The dreams you will chase and the goals you will achieve. Let this moment be one that reminds you of how far you’ve come and how far you will go.

    There is no mountain too high. You are capable. You will do this.

    Good luck, and may God continue to bless and guide you throughout this journey.
